Image::Magick/ PerlMagick on Windows 2000!
I feel close to getting this to work....and writing scripts to rip through my extensive image files and autocrop and resize them. Active State Perl and ImageMagick seem to be running fine, but PerlMagick seems to be generating errors:
#!c:/perl -w
use strict;
use Image::Magick;
my $image = new Image::Magick;
my $x = $image->Read("nettie.tif");
warn "$x" if "$x";
$x = $image->Scale(width=>"200", height=>"200");
warn "$x" if "$x";
$x = $image->Write("nettienew.tif");
warn "$x" if "$x";
Generates these errors:
Exception 420: NoDecodeDelegateForThisImageFormat (nettie.tif) at c:/image.pl line 8.
Anybody have a suggestion about what might be happening and how to proceed?
